Why gold, silver, lead and Copper do not react with water at all?

Dear Student,
Metals react with water and produce metal oxides and hydrogen gas. The reaction depends upon the reactivity of metals.But metals such as lead,silver,gold and copper do not react with metals at all.Gold and silver do not react with water at all ,because gold and silver are least reactive and the surface of metallic lead is protected by a thin layer of lead oxide, PbO. Hence, it does not react with water under normal conditions.
